What Is a Crane Truck?

crane truck is a vehicle that has both:

  • regular truck body for moving around
  • power crane that can lift and move heavy loads

These trucks are very helpful on construction sites because they can both drive to different places and lift heavy things when they get there.

How Crane Trucks Work

Main Parts

Crane trucks have these important parts:

  • Crane arm: Can be telescopic (stretches out) or knuckleboom (folds like your arm)
  • Hydraulic system: Uses fluid power to lift heavy things
  • Stabilizers: Keep the truck from tipping when lifting
  • Load monitors: Tell the driver how much weight is safe

The newest crane trucks in 2025 have smart technology that helps them lift heavier loads more safely than ever before.

Types of Crane Trucks

TypeWhat It DoesBest Uses
Truck-Mounted CranesCrane sits on truck bedGeneral lifting, can drive on regular roads
Boom TrucksLong arm reaches farConstruction, utilities, concrete work
Knuckle Boom CranesArm folds like kneesTight spaces, precise placement
Telescopic CranesArm extends outReaching high places

Some special models like the Revolution 84RM can reach 84 feet high but don’t need a special license to drive!

What Crane Trucks Are Used For

Crane trucks help in many different jobs:

  • Building sites: Moving steel beams, concrete panels, and big equipment
  • Road work: Fixing bridges and signs
  • Home building: Lifting roof trusses and heavy walls
  • Tree work: Removing large trees safely
  • Rescue work: Helping in emergencies to move heavy things

The best thing about crane trucks is they can both drive places AND lift heavy things when they get there.

The newest crane trucks in 2025 have some cool new features:

Smart Technology

New trucks have computers and sensors that:

  • Show how much weight is safe to lift
  • Warn when the truck might tip over
  • Track how the truck is working
  • Tell when parts need fixing

Eco-Friendly Options

More crane trucks now use:

  • Electric motors instead of gas
  • Hybrid systems that use less fuel
  • Better hydraulics that waste less energy

Bigger Lifting Power

The most popular models in 2025 are the 75-100 USt four-axle models that can lift very heavy loads but still drive on regular roads.

Safety Rules for Crane Trucks

Safety is very important with crane trucks:

  • Always check the weight limit before lifting
  • Put out stabilizers to keep from tipping
  • Keep people away from under the lifting area
  • Follow all OSHA rules for crane safety
  • Make sure drivers have proper training

Crane Truck Costs

Buying a crane truck in 2025 costs:

  • Small models: $150,000-$300,000
  • Medium models: $300,000-$600,000
  • Large models: $600,000-$1,500,000

Many companies rent truck-mounted cranes instead of buying because they’re expensive.
